  • Can you clean parquet floors in Forest Hills co-ops without damaging them?

    Yes, and this is one of the surfaces we pay the most specific attention to in Forest Hills. Original parquet floors in pre-war co-ops are beautiful and durable when cleaned correctly, and they warp or lift at the edges when cleaned with too much water or the wrong product. We use a light, controlled mop technique with products specifically safe for older parquet. If your floors have had problems with previous cleaning services, tell us when you book and we'll make sure the team knows the history of the surface before they touch it.

How does Queens Boulevard traffic affect cleaning in Forest Hills apartments?

  • How does Queens Boulevard traffic affect cleaning in Forest Hills apartments?

    Apartments with windows facing Queens Boulevard accumulate exhaust grime and particulate on their sills and the surfaces near the front windows at a noticeably faster rate than apartments on the quieter side streets. The boulevard handles a very heavy volume of traffic and the buildup on front-facing sills in a Forest Hills co-op is a genuine recurring cleaning issue. We pay extra attention to those sills and tracks on every visit for clients with Boulevard-facing apartments, and we use a product that cuts through that specific type of exhaust residue rather than just spreading it around.

  • How does the change of seasons affect cleaning in Forest Hills?

    Forest Hills has a pronounced seasonal effect on home cleaning. In fall, the mature trees throughout the Gardens and on the residential streets shed heavily, and leaves and organic debris track in on shoes from late October through November. In winter, the salt used on Queens Boulevard sidewalks and the surrounding streets tracks in on shoes and leaves a white residue on floors, particularly near entryways. Spring brings pollen from the boulevard trees and the residential plantings throughout the Gardens. Each season shifts which parts of the home need the most attention, and a consistent maid service team that knows your home adapts to that naturally over time.
